Breaking News: Local developers suing GreenBank/American Fidelity


By Rick Laney
of The Daily Times Staff


A local construction company filed suit in Blount County Chancery Court Wednesday against American Fidelity Bank and its parent company, GreenBank, for alleged violation of the Tennessee Consumer Protection Act, negligent misrepresentation, intentional misrepresentation and breach of contract.

The suit stems from loans made by American Fidelity to Potter & Sunderland General Contractors Inc., a Louisville-based construction company that developed the Ashwood Park Villas near the intersection of William Blount Drive and Dotson Memorial Road.

The complaint is based on what the developers say were misleading terms and conditions of their loans with American Fidelity and GreenBank and an attempt by American Fidelity to keep the developers from obtaining construction loans from Citizens Bank of Blount County.
